TE-OH Japanese Nippon pieces are sold frequently on EBay, Etsy, etc. Fortunately you paid a good price. Unfortunately you won't get $$$ rich on it.
Depending on size of your piece can give you an average value. What size is your piece?

On the internet, this is referred to as T-China, Te-Oh, E-Oh, Je-Oh and on occasions - my personal favourite - Tohina ( the c being misread as an o )
